WHAT AND WHY:

 

Have you ever wondered what qualities enable certain people, organizations or communities to thrive despite unexpected challenges? D4R is a full-day exploration of resilience as a strategy for thriving in an uncertain world. And a call to action to prepare for the crises and opportunities unfolding today. 

 

D4R will empower you to explore resilience through a combination of presentations and workshops (in Open Space format). As an Open Space participant, you’ll collaborate with innovators from the social enterprise, design thinking, transition town, network science, local economy, urban planning, green evangelical, open source, public media, and positive psychology communities to create a unique, cross-sector learning experience.

 

At D4R, you’ll:

  • Add resilience thinking to your strategy toolbox
  • Build relationships across sectors by learning with diverse participants
  • Take home valuable insights to apply in your life and work.  

 

D4R is designed for those managing dramatic change in business and civil society, and are determined to thrive on the challenge.

 

Oh, and the How:  Our speakers will talk about design thinking, resilience, and the commons in the morning to set the context. The afternoon will be Open Space. You’re encouraged to facilitate a session on a topic of choice rethinking it from a resilience perspective.

 

WHEN / WHERE:

 

WHEN:  April 10th, 2010, 8:30-5:00

WHERE:  D4R will be held at The Hub Berkeley, (2150 Allston Way, #400, Berkeley, CA.) a co-working and events center for social enterprise. D4R will be the first in a series of events culminating in a D4R presence at SOCAP10. This is your invitation to inaugurate the D4R community.

COST: $75 via the EventBrite site,  Includes a DELICIOUS BOX LUNCH PROVIDED to take into sessions.
